


body       { line-height: 0; background-image: url("../image15/gal15tfpageback.jpg"); background-repeat: repeat; background-position: center 0 }
.t1    { background-image: url("../image15/gal15tf1.png") }
.t4    { background-image: url("../image15/gal15tf4.png") }
.subtop { display: block; width: 100%; height: 20% }
.top { display: block; width: 100%; height: 20% }
.cara { display: block; width: 100%; height: 20% }
.list { display: block; width: 100%; height: 20% }
.home { display: block; width: 100%; height: 20% }
@media screen and (max-width:640px){
	body     { background-image: url("../image15/gal15mobback.jpg"); background-repeat: repeat; margin: 0 }
	.t1         { background-image: url("../image15/galback15mob.png"); background-position: center 0; width: 100%; height: 40px; float: none }
	.t2  { width: 100%; height: auto; float: none }
	.t3  { width: 100%; height: auto; float: none }
	.t4          { background-image: url("../image15/galnext15mob.png"); background-position: center 0; width: 100%; height: 40px; float: none }
	#center   { background-position: center bottom }
	.subtop  { background-image: url("../../comic/15trance/short15mobsubtop.png"); background-position: center 0; width: 20%; height: 40px; float: left }
	.top { background-image: url("../../comic/15trance/short15mobtop.png"); background-position: center 0; width: 20%; height: 40px; float: left }
	.cara { background-image: url("../../comic/15trance/short15mobcara.png"); background-position: center 0; width: 20%; height: 40px; float: left }
	.list { background-image: url("../../comic/15trance/short15moblist.png"); background-position: center 0; width: 20%; height: 40px; float: left }
	.home { background-image: url("../../comic/15trance/short15mobhome.png"); background-position: center 0; width: 20%; height: 40px; float: left }
}
@media print {
	body { display: none }
}

